Archive Reference / Library Class No.
D3155/WH/1390
Title
Surrender by Nicholas Whiting and Alice his wife and Henry Whiting son and heir of a rood of arable land in the Wheatfield of Barton near to a furlong called Coningrey: admittance of John Jobson and Sarah his wife. Dated 25 October
Date
1643
Level
file
Repository
Derbyshire Record Office
Archive Creator
Manor of Barton under Needwood
Wilmot-Horton family of Osmaston and Catton, Derbyshire
